Transaction 75e37ece83ee4882eb274789ed3ab146c08eb4d5d0b95e5e35c5bc005f1f81c8

2 Input
2 Outputs
  • 75e37ece83ee4882eb274789ed3ab146c08eb4d5d0b95e5e35c5bc005f1f81c8:0
  • value  1690529
    address  3HfqRicke1mZPEygZRTsAhyjgSTfDomcDA
  • 75e37ece83ee4882eb274789ed3ab146c08eb4d5d0b95e5e35c5bc005f1f81c8:1
  • value  3599
    address  1GKLRwQnmEoQmAcF27oDwFWoQr8anzqrgy